Iran: Number of daily virus cases quadruple

TEHRAN 

Iran on Thursday confirmed 59 more fatalities from coronavirus, bringing the nationwide death toll to 8,071.

A further 3,574 people tested positive for the virus over the past 24 hours, raising the overall count to 164,270, Health Ministry spokesman Kianoush Jahanpour said.

Thursday's daily figures of infections have quadrupled from last month's average.

The country's daily number of virus-related cases decreased to 800s in early May, but daily figures show an upward trend in recent days after authorities took measures to ease restrictions.

Jahanpour said 127,485 patients have recovered and been discharged from hospitals so far, while 2,569 patients remain in critical condition.

Over 1 million tests have been conducted in the country so far, according to the ministry.

Despite the rising number of cases, government employees have resumed work, and mosques reopened across the Middle Eastern country.

Shopping malls are now open beyond 6 p.m. (1330GMT).
